Transaction 63e68d37a0ef0095470165e595c8b9764ad1006b33918df8a4bc96161e32cfe9

1 Input
2 Outputs
  • 63e68d37a0ef0095470165e595c8b9764ad1006b33918df8a4bc96161e32cfe9:0
  • value  7822700
    address  17sZAxTxJJimb5iq9QVSDUNNrT8ixZysBX
  • 63e68d37a0ef0095470165e595c8b9764ad1006b33918df8a4bc96161e32cfe9:1
  • value  24869478
    address  15xQrri1DCETTQLbwG7N1iypbCBRYqACkr